Why Mount Carmel?

With five hospitals, over 60 free-standing outpatient clinics, a college of nursing, a Medicare Advantage plan, and extensive outreach and community wellness programs, Mount Carmel Health System serves more than a million patients in central Ohio each year, and we've been a pillar of this community for more than 130 years. As a proud member of Trinity Health, one of the nation's largest Catholic healthcare delivery systems, our network of caring spans 22 states, 94 hospitals, and 133,000 colleagues nationwide.

About the job:

The Clinical Manager, under the direction of the Nurse Manager or Department Director, plans, organizes, staffs and directs patient care on a daily operational basis in accordance with the Ohio Nurse Practice Act. Functions within the standards, policies, procedures and guidelines of the Organization.

What you will do:

  • Holds self and others (Colleagues, Physicians and Volunteers) accountable for exhibiting each of the Mount Carmel Service Excellence Behavior Standards. This includes, but is not limited to, celebrating excellence in behavior and approaching anyone with courtesy and respect who is not demonstrating Service Excellence and owning and resolving Service Recovery concerns.
  • Creates a caring and healing environment that keeps the patient and family at the center of care throughout their experience at Mount Carmel following the principles of our interdisciplinary care delivery system.
  • Identify, lead and embrace change.
  • Under the direction of the nurse manager/director provides supervision of employees in their respective department/service area and partners with their supervisor to ensure 24 hour accountability. Participates in interviewing, hiring, orienting, counseling and evaluating of all employees. Establishes work schedules and daily assignments. Participates in direct patient care activities as needed.
  • Develops and maintains effective working relationships with staff, other departments and physicians.
  • Promotes a Culture of Safety by adhering to policy, procedures and plans that are in place to prevent workplace injury, violence or adverse outcome to colleagues and patients.

What we are looking for:

  • Graduate from school of nursing; BSN required
  • Current license to practice as a Registered Nurse in the State of Ohio
  • Minimum of two year's recent and relevant clinical experience required
  • Effective Communication Skills
  • Demonstrates the ability to plan, organize and manage patient care, including delegation to and supervision of other members of the patient care team
